Four new container gantry cranes for Abidjan Terminal

Abidjan. 11 April 2017

In order to increase the operational capacity of Abidjan’s container terminal, four new gantry cranes (RTG) were put into service. These new modern equipments will help improve the port of Abidjan development.

[Translate to English:] Portiques de Parc - Abidjan Terminal - Bolloré

Over the past few days, four new RTG have been introduced on Abidjan Terminal. In addition to the existing 16 container gantry cranes, those new equipments will strengthen the attractiveness of Abidjan’s container terminal.

They will increase the rotation of the containers on the park and thus reduce the duration of the logistics loop. With an investment of more than 4 billion FCFA, Abidjan Terminal, concession of Bolloré Ports, makes a significant contribution to help increase the volumes of full containers processed in the Port of Abidjan. Which is the main gateway for trade in Côte d'Ivoire and the countries of the hinterland, like Burkina Faso, Mali...
